Class Teacher job summary
Class Teacher
In this role, you will take responsibility for and teach a class of children, ensuring that planning, preparation, recording, assessment, and reporting meet their varying learning and social needs. You will undertake duties in line with the professional standards for qualified teachers and uphold the professional code of the General Teaching Council for England, carrying out the professional duties covered by the latest School Teachers' Pay and Conditions Document. You will maintain the positive ethos and core values of the school, both inside and outside the classroom , and contribute to constructive team building amongst staff, parents, and governors.
